A FIBC BULK BAGS manufacturer in India (Flexible Intermediate Bulk Container) is a large, durable woven polypropylene bag used for storing and transporting dry, flowable materials like grains, sand, or chemicals. These bags typically hold 500–2000 kg and are designed with lifting loops for easy handling by forklifts or cranes, offering a cost-effective and space-saving bulk packaging solution.
